Understanding Money Luck in Feng Shui

In feng shui, luck is not random. It is shaped by three main types of energy:

  1. Heaven Luck – what you are born with (timing, destiny, circumstances).
  2. Earth Luck – the environment you live and work in.
  3. Human Luck – your actions, mindset, and decisions.

While you cannot control Heaven Luck, you can absolutely influence Earth Luck and Human Luck. Feng shui focuses on improving Earth Luck—your physical surroundings—so that it supports your goals instead of quietly working against them.

When your environment aligns with prosperity, your habits, confidence, and motivation naturally improve. This is how money luck is cultivated.

Step 2: Activate Your Wealth Sector

In classical feng shui, each area of your home corresponds to a different life aspect. The southeast sector is traditionally associated with wealth and abundance.

How to Locate It:

Stand at your main entrance facing into your home. The far-left corner is typically the wealth area.

How to Activate It:

  • Add healthy green plants.
  • Use wooden furniture or decor.
  • Include symbols of prosperity.
  • Keep the area well-lit.

Avoid placing rubbish bins, broken furniture, or sharp objects here. These weaken wealth energy.

This area should feel alive, fresh, and uplifting.


Step 3: Strengthen Your Front Door for Opportunity Flow

Your front door is known as the “mouth of qi.” This is where all opportunities—financial and otherwise—enter your home.

If your door is damaged, dark, cluttered, or blocked, you may feel like money is always just out of reach.

Simple Fixes:

  • Ensure your door opens fully.
  • Replace broken handles or squeaky hinges.
  • Add good lighting.
  • Place a clean doormat.
  • Remove clutter nearby.

A welcoming entrance sends a subconscious message that you are open to receiving abundance.


Step 4: Use Water Energy to Symbolize Wealth Flow

Water is strongly associated with wealth in feng shui. Flowing water symbolizes steady income, opportunities, and movement.

Ways to Incorporate Water Energy:

  • Small tabletop fountains
  • Aquariums
  • Artwork of rivers, oceans, or waterfalls

Important Rules:

  • Keep water clean and moving.
  • Avoid placing water features in bedrooms.
  • Avoid images of floods or storms.

A gently flowing water feature in your living room or near the entrance can symbolically activate money flow.

Step 8: Fix Leaks, Breaks, and Neglect

In feng shui, physical problems often symbolize energetic issues.

  • Leaking faucets = money draining away
  • Broken clocks = stagnation
  • Flickering lights = unstable income
  • Cracked mirrors = distorted self-worth

Fixing these small issues sends a powerful message to your subconscious: you value stability and prosperity.
